Bug 5032

Summary: nothing provides python2-pygpgme needed by dropbox-1:2015.10.28-8.fc29.noarch
Product: Fedora Reporter: Kamil Páral <kparal>
Component: nautilus-dropboxAssignee: Wolfgang Ulbrich <fedora>
Status: RESOLVED FIXED    
Severity: enhancement CC: fedora, leigh123linux
Priority: P1    
Version: f29   
Hardware: x86_64   
OS: GNU/Linux   
namespace:

Description Kamil Páral 2018-09-25 09:59:51 CEST
Dropbox from rpmfusion can't be installed on F29 due to broken dependencies. However, dropbox from official site can be installed just fine (I have it installed). The problem is that rpmfusion contains a newer package version, and therefore I see broken dependencies report every time I want to update my system.

$ rpm -q nautilus-dropbox
nautilus-dropbox-2015.10.28-1.fc10.x86_64

$ sudo dnf update nautilus-dropbox --best
Last metadata expiration check: 0:02:38 ago on Tue 25 Sep 2018 10:03:51 AM CEST.
Error: 
 Problem: package nautilus-dropbox-1:2015.10.28-8.fc29.x86_64 requires dropbox >= 1:2015.10.28-8.fc29, but none of the providers can be installed
  - cannot install the best update candidate for package nautilus-dropbox-2015.10.28-1.fc10.x86_64
  - nothing provides python2-pygpgme needed by dropbox-1:2015.10.28-8.fc29.noarch
Comment 1 leigh scott 2018-09-25 11:23:08 CEST
(In reply to Kamil Páral from comment #0)
> Dropbox from rpmfusion can't be installed on F29 due to broken dependencies.
> However, dropbox from official site can be installed just fine (I have it
> installed). The problem is that rpmfusion contains a newer package version,
> and therefore I see broken dependencies report every time I want to update
> my system.
> 

The dropbox.com package probably has missing python deps so still installs ok.
python2-pygpgme dep was recently removed (2018)

https://github.com/dropbox/nautilus-dropbox/commit/e9367206f9b723103362e8dd154363517e9a9841


Fixed in nautilus-dropbox-2015.10.28-9.fc29

https://koji.rpmfusion.org/koji/buildinfo?buildID=8869
Comment 2 Kamil Páral 2018-09-25 12:34:52 CEST
That works, thanks. Please push to repos.